Kamloops Blazers: Tactical Approach and Current Form
The Kamloops Blazers have been in strong form in their last five games, showing solid offensive firepower combined with a reliable defensive structure. Their playstyle is centered around fast breakouts from the defensive zone, often transitioning into high-pressure forechecks in the offensive end. The Blazers excel in power plays, boasting a strong conversion rate (over 20%) while also having a disciplined penalty kill. With a heavy reliance on their top line to generate offense, they are a dangerous team in transition.
Key players for Kamloops include their captain, a top-tier playmaker who has been consistently setting up scoring opportunities. In addition, their goaltender has been solid between the pipes with a .915 save percentage, keeping them competitive even in tight games. However, the Blazers have a few injuries that could impact their depth, including a key defenseman who is recovering from a minor knock, which could leave them vulnerable in their own zone if he’s unavailable.
Red Deer Rebels: Tactical Approach and Current Form
The Red Deer Rebels have been on a strong run of form recently, winning four of their last five. Their system revolves around a strong forecheck and aggressive puck possession in the offensive zone. The Rebels excel at winning battles along the boards and creating space for their skilled forwards. Their penalty kill has been exceptional, holding opponents to just under 75% on the power play. While their offense isn’t as explosive as Kamloops’, the Rebels are solid in all areas and can suffocate teams with their defensive consistency.
One standout player for the Rebels has been their top center, who is not only a reliable point producer but also excels in the faceoff circle, giving them control of possession in key situations. In addition, their goaltender has been playing at an elite level with a .920 save percentage. However, the Rebels have dealt with a few injuries in their bottom six forwards, which has limited their depth. If they are unable to recover these players, it could shift the balance of power in this game.
Head-to-Head: History and Psychology
The last few matchups between the Kamloops Blazers and the Red Deer Rebels have been tightly contested, with each team taking two wins in the past five meetings. Most recently, the Rebels edged out the Blazers with a late goal in a 4-3 win, but earlier in the season, Kamloops’ high-powered offense had the better of the Rebels in a 5-2 victory. These games have typically been characterized by tight, tactical play with few mistakes, highlighting the importance of special teams and timely scoring. Both teams have been known to come out strong in the first period, but as the game wears on, the Rebels tend to grind their opponents down with their defensive game.
Key Battles and Critical Zones
One critical battle will be in the faceoff circle. The Rebels’ center, known for his ability to win key draws, will be crucial in giving his team possession and controlling the flow of the game. Kamloops will need to win more of these battles to limit Red Deer’s ability to establish a forecheck. Another key area will be the Blazers’ power play vs. the Rebels’ penalty kill. Kamloops will need to capitalize on their power play opportunities to break through Red Deer’s defensive structure, while the Rebels will look to frustrate the Blazers and keep them off the scoreboard when they have the man advantage.
Lastly, the goaltending matchup will be pivotal. Both teams have top-tier netminders, but whichever team can create more traffic in front of the opposing goalie will have a significant advantage. If Kamloops can get their shots through and create rebounds, it could be the difference. Likewise, Red Deer will look to capitalize on any weak-side chances and convert on turnovers in the neutral zone.
